Abstract
Saigon – Cho Lon became a developed town under the Nguyen Dynasty with domestic and foreign trade exchanges, but this urban area was not complete and synchronous. When France waged a war of aggression and occupied Cochinchina six provinces with the intention of annexing the whole of Vietnam and expanding its influence in the Far East, France carried out a project to build urban areas and develop infrastructure. to transform Saigon - Cho Lon into the urban center of Cochinchina with the capitalist mode of production. Using historical and logical methods, analysis and documentation, the paper presents the basic factors affecting the urbanization process of Saigon - Cho Lon that change the economic and social face of Cochinchina in the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
